    If I had the money I'd probably get my prescription glasses with these adaptive lenses. Quick question, can the photochemical lenses have a custom tint done on top of the adaptive lenses? I am very light sensitive so clear lenses are only suitable for night time driving.

    • @thespectaclefactory
      @thespectaclefactory  2 роки тому +4

      Hi Anthony, unfortunately that isn't technically possible since the heat needed to make the lens absorb the tint would also damage the light-sensitive film. But even if it was possible, since the lenses already go to 97% darkness, a tint over the top of that would render the lenses unusuable.

    The website states that “all AdaptiveSun lenses are not suitable for driving”. Should I be aware of any side effects/risks it poses wearing them while driving?

    • @thespectaclefactory
      @thespectaclefactory  3 роки тому +5

      Great question. They have to say this because Adaptive Sun lenses can get darker than the legal limit (90%). However this would only happen in extreme UV situations outside of the car. Theoretically you could get in your car after the lenses have darkened and it would be illegal to drive with them (or perhaps if you have a convertible they could also become too dark) but in real life I doubt this would ever be an issue...
